Diagnostic Criteria

Signs & symptoms: Clinically, the congenital myopathies have several common features: geenralized weakness, hypotonia,hyporeflexia, poor muscle bulk, and dysmorphic features such as pectus carinatum, scoliosis, foot deformities, high arched palate and elongated facies, secondary to the myopathy. Can be inherited in an autosomal dominant, autosomal recessive, or x-linked pattern.
